The LA Galaxy midfielder opened up on what it was like to play with the striker during his two-year stint in MLSLA Galaxy midfielder Joe Corona says that it was a "privilege" to play alongside Zlatan Ibrahimovic in the wake of criticism of the Swedish star's treatment of teammates during his stay in MLS.Ibrahimovic spent two seasons with the Galaxy, firing 53 goals in 58 games before leaving Los Angeles to rejoin AC Milan.Despite his success, team success eluded Ibrahimovic and the Galaxy during his time in MLS as he failed to guide the team to an MLS Cup.Editors' PicksIn the months since his departure, the striker has been the subject of criticism from former teammates as stories have emerged regarding his time in California.Galaxy midfielder Sebastian Lletget says the atmosphere at the club has improved since the Swede left, saying it was "super-frustrating" to play with him at times.San Jose Earthquakes star Florian Jungwirth recalled.a match against the…
